CUK’s Deptt of IT celebrates 25th ‘National Technology Day’

Ganderbal : The department of Information Technology, Central University of Kashmir (CUK) on Thursday celebrated the 25th National Technology Day with zeal and zest.
According to the statement issued from Public Relations Office Central University of Kashmir the celebrations started with the screening of the address by Prime Minister Narendra Modi, live from Pragithi Maidan, New Delhi.
Meeting the requirements of this year’s theme, “School to startups – Igniting Young minds to Innovate”, the department organised several activities including interaction of experts from IT Industry with the students.
Welcoming the experts, Deptt Coordinator, Er. Afaq Alam Khan, said that celebrating the National Technology Day provides us an opportunity to acknowledge the incredible achievements of scientists, engineers and technologists who contributed towards the growth and development of the nation through their innovation and breakthroughs.
During the first phase of the event, Director, Winnovation, Mr. Sarbarinder Singh, Lead Trainer, Winnovation Mr. Faizan Rashid, Zonal Channel Manager, SOTI, Mr. Navdeep Singh Sodhi interacted with the students. Mr. Faizan Rashid, spoke about the skill set required by the students for getting better placement in the industry.
Second technical session started with the presentation by students including Ms Sidrat Shafiq and Ms Fiqa Hilal, of B.Tech CSE who spoke about the “Artificial Intelligence” while as Ms. Sauda and Ms. Huzaifa delivered their presentations on the “Chat GPT” and “Augmented Reality” respectively.
The presentations were followed by the expert talk on “Front End Application Development” by Er. Firous Ahmad, CEO, Marvel Minds. Er. Feroz Ahmad, Mr. Syed Basit, and Mr. Riyaz Ahmad were among other experts from Marvel Minds. The event was attended by the students and faculty members of the Department.
